Google Sheets
Workflow Template

Scrape Job Listings from Google Jobs and Save to Google Sheets

This workflow automates the process of scraping job listings from Google Jobs and saving them to Google Sheets, streamlining job searches and recruitment.
Scrape data on active tab
Add data to sheet tab
Workflow Overview

This workflow automates the process of scraping job listings from Google Jobs and saving them to Google Sheets, streamlining job searches and recruitment.
  • Google Jobs search results page
  • Scraper model
  • Target Google Sheet for results
  • Job listings data in Google Sheets

This automation scrapes job listings from Google Jobs and saves the data directly into a specified Google Sheet.

First, it uses a combined scraper model on the active tab where Google Jobs search results are displayed, extracting relevant job listing information. Following the successful scraping, the extracted data is appended into a pre-designated Google Sheet tab. This workflow is ideal for:

  • Recruiters tracking job openings
  • Job seekers monitoring new listings
Note: While this workflow is set for Google Jobs and Google Sheets, Bardeen's modularity allows it to be adapted for use with other data sources and destinations such as Coda, Airtable, or CRM systems like Salesforce and HubSpot.

Enhance your job search or recruitment process efficiently with this powerful automation by installing Bardeen.

Step 1: Install the Bardeen App

To start, ensure you install the Bardeen app on your device.

Step 2: Navigate to the Magic Box

After installation, proceed to the Magic Box and enter the following:

scrape job listing from Google Jobs, save into google sheets

Step 3: Integrate the Workflow Integrations

Make sure to set up the required integrations for the workflow. This involves integrating Google Sheets for saving the scraped job listings.

Step 4: Run the Workflow

Lastly, execute the workflow. This workflow is structured to:

  • Scrape job listing information from Google Jobs using a specified model.
  • It then appends the scraped job listings into the designated Google Sheet.
How to Efficiently Scrape Job Listings from Google Jobs

Scraping Job Postings from Google Jobs

Finding the right job postings can be a daunting task, especially when you have to sift through multiple job boards and company websites. This is where scraping job postings from Google Jobs comes into play, offering a streamlined approach to gathering job listings efficiently. In this guide, we'll explore how to manually scrape job listings from Google Jobs and introduce you to job scraping tools that can automate the process.

Manual Scraping from Google Jobs

For those who prefer a hands-on approach or need to scrape a small number of job listings, manual scraping from Google Jobs is a viable option. Here's how you can do it:

  1. Start by navigating to Google and typing in your job search query along with the word "jobs" (e.g., "software engineer jobs").
  2. Google Jobs aggregates listings from various job boards and company websites, presenting them in a unified interface. Click on the "Jobs" tab to view the listings.
  3. Review the job listings and click on the ones that interest you. Google Jobs will provide a summary of the job posting, including the job title, company name, location, and a brief description. For more details, you'll be directed to the original job posting on the company's website or job board.
  4. To manually scrape the information, you can copy and paste the job details into a spreadsheet or document for further analysis or tracking.

While manual scraping is straightforward, it can be time-consuming if you're looking to gather a large number of job listings.

Using Job Scraping Tools

For those who need to scrape job listings at scale, several job scraping tools can automate the process, saving you time and effort. These tools can extract job listings from Google Jobs and other sources, providing you with a comprehensive dataset of job postings. Some popular job scraping tools include:

  • Bardeen: Automate repetitive tasks, including scraping job listings from Google Jobs and saving them into Google Sheets. Bardeen's no-code automation capabilities make it easy to set up and run job scraping automations without any programming knowledge.
  • Apify: Offers a Google Jobs Scraper tool that can crawl Google Jobs Search Results Pages and extract data in structured formats such as JSON, XML, CSV, or Excel. Apify's solution is ideal for developers and businesses needing customizable scraping capabilities.
  • Octoparse and Zyte: These platforms provide web scraping services that can be configured to extract job listings from various sources, including Google Jobs. They offer user-friendly interfaces and powerful scraping features suitable for both beginners and experienced users.
When choosing a job scraping tool, consider factors such as ease of use, customization options, scalability, and cost. Additionally, ensure that your scraping activities comply with the terms of service of the websites you're scraping from to avoid any legal issues.

In summary, scraping job postings from Google Jobs can significantly enhance your job search or recruitment efforts. Whether you prefer manual scraping for a small number of listings or automated tools for large-scale scraping, the right approach can provide you with valuable insights and opportunities in the job market.

